National Locums is working on behalf of an NHS trust based in the Midlands, seeking a locum Consultant in Hepatology. The Medicine department at this NHS trust requires a locum Consultant to start as soon as possible, initially for 3 months.

Working Hours and Job Plan

  • Core hours: Monday – Friday, 09:00-17:00
  • Workload: 10 PAs per week, covering a mix of wards and outpatient clinics

Requirements

  • GMC license to practise
  • Full right to work in the UK
  • Minimum 12 months NHS experience in Hepatology
